Indiana Code 25-34.1-10-16. Liability for misrepresentation

Sec. 16. (a) A client is not liable for any misrepresentation made by a licensee in connection with the agency relationship, unless the client knew or should have known of the misrepresentation.
(b) A licensee is not liable for any misrepresentation made by another licensee, unless the licensee knew or should have known of the other licensee’s misrepresentation.Terms Used In Indiana Code 25-34.1-10-16
As added by P.L.128-1994, SEC.6. Amended by P.L.130-1999, SEC.21.
